Turtle knows that he's living the perfect life, and doesn't care he's gotten there by riding Vince's coattails. Always on the hustle, Turtle takes advantage of every opportunity LA has to offer. Loyal to Vince and dedicated to maintaining the LA lifestyle, Turtle is now in charge of running the day-to-day operations of the house.
